A treat for singers and audience alike, the evening will feature Vivaldi’s 'Gloria' and JS Bach’s 'Magnificat', perhaps two of the greatest sacred choral works ever written. The Vivaldi will be performed together with past conductors and members. Southern Voices are also thrilled to welcome Endelienta Baroque, an outstandingly talented group of young artists, who recreate the orchestral soundscape for which Bach and Vivaldi composed, performing on historical instruments. The concert opens with two relatively new works by composer Matthew Martin, beginning festivities with settings of 'Laudate Dominum' and 'Jubilate Deo', celebratory music for the most celebratory of occasions.

Do come along and join Southern Voices for what will be a wonderful evening. Soloists will be: Lucy Cronin & Lucy Mellors soprano, Claire Sutton-Williams mezzo-soprano, 
Gwilym Bowen tenor, Jamie W Hall baritone Jamal Sutton conductor. Tickets are £35 for the concert and Gala Reception afterwards, where the fun continues with drinks, canapés, speeches, surprises and more singing!
